411 Box Office Report: Avatar Tops Sherlock Holmes
Posted by Ashish on 12.27.2009



James Cameron has another massive hit on his hands. Avatar continued to soar at the holiday box office this weekend, earning $75 million to raise its domestic total to $212.2 million, good for the second biggest second weekend ever (behind The Dark Knight which earned $75.1 million in its second weekend). The film had the highest per theater average of any in the top 10 with $21,701 per theater. The film is thus far performing well above expectations. The film managed to not really drop at all from its first weekend to its second, a very rare accomplishment for blockbusters which usually drop 50% or more in its second weekend. The film has now grossed $402.9 million overseas, bringing its worldwide total to $615.1 million.

Sherlock Holmes debuted at #2 with $65.3 million with a per theater average of $18,031. The debut was good for the fifth biggest December opening ever (I Am Legend remains #1 with $77.2 million, followed by Avatar with $77 million). The film earned $24.7 million on Christmas Day, a new record. The debut is also the second biggest debut ever to not land in the #1 spot, behind The Day After Tomorrow which earned $68.7 million but also debuted at #2.

Alvin and the Chipmunks: The Squeakquel debuted at #3 with $50.2 million.

It's Complicated debuted at #4 with $22.1 million.

Up In The Air moved up three spots to #8 in its fourth weekend, earning $11.75 million to raise its total gross to $24.5 million. The film had a $25 million budget.

The Blind Side fell three spots to #6 in its sixth weekend, earning $11.73 million to raise its total gross to $184.3 million. The film had a budget of $29 million.

The Princess and the Frog fell five spots to #7 in its fifth weekend, earning $8.6 million to raise its total gross to $63.3 million. The film had a budget of $105 million.

Nine expanded and shot up 12 spots to #8 with $5.5 million, raising its two week total to $5.9 million. The film had a budget of $80 million.

Did You Hear About The Morgans? fell five spots to #9 with $5 million, raising its two week total to $15.5 million. The film had a budget of $58 million.

Invictus fell four spots to #10 in its third weekend, earning $4.3 million to raise its total gross to $23.3 million. The film had a budget of $60 million.
